A Description of a Shock Wave in Free Particle Hydrodynamics with Internal Magnetic Fields

Description: Abstract: "The structure of an extremely strong magnetohydrodynamic shock is discussed in the limit of no particle collisions. It is tentatively concluded that the shock transition takes place through the mechanism of a strong electric field produced by charge separation. The pressure in the shocked plasma is due primarily to a very high electron temperature. The ions, on the other hand, undergo an irreversible temperature change of only 3."

A High-Current Radio-Frequency Ion Accellerator

Description: Abstract: "A radio-frequency ion accelerator is described which is capable of continuous currents of protons of 250 ma at an energy of 500 kev. The beam is less than 3 in. in diameter and has a divergence of less than 2 degree half angle. Operation of the machine accelerating deuterons to an energy of 1000 kev is also described."
